November 13: Testimony by Jessica Vaughn

From the mountain tops of life where happiness prevails to the dark, angry valleys of despair after miscarriages, Jessica Vaughn, niece of church leader Moir Beamer, provided a powerful testimony. She shared how through it all, God provides, guides and teaches. For those with open hearts and minds, the result is a more fulfilling life, greater love and a steadfast faith.

November 6: And So It Begins

Reverend Dan Austin, Executive Director of Christian Children’s Home Joy Ranch, delivered a sermon based on 1 Samuel 16. The versus he shared illustrate how God knows and reveals his knowledge and plans to believers, encouraging unwaivering faith in God.
